*
* Create a new +SystemExit+ exception with the given _status_ and _message_.
* If _status_ is not given, EXIT_SUCCESS is used.
*
* _status_ should be +true+, +false+ or an integer.
* +true+ means EXIT_SUCCESS and +false+ means EXIT_FAILURE.
*
* _message_ should be a string.
*
